Package ch.bailu.gtk.glib
Klasse TokenValue
java.lang.Object
ch.bailu.gtk.type.Type
ch.bailu.gtk.type.Pointer
ch.bailu.gtk.type.Record
ch.bailu.gtk.glib.TokenValue
- Alle implementierten Schnittstellen:
PointerInterface
A union holding the value of the token.
-
Feldübersicht
FelderModifizierer und TypFeldBeschreibungstatic final String
token binary integer valuestatic final String
character valuestatic final String
comment valuestatic final String
error valuestatic final String
floating point valuestatic final String
hex integer valuestatic final String
token identifier valuestatic final String
integer valuestatic final String
64-bit integer valuestatic final String
octal integer valuestatic final String
string valuestatic final String
token symbol value -
Konstruktorübersicht
Konstruktoren -
Methodenübersicht
Modifizierer und TypMethodeBeschreibungstatic ClassHandler
long
token binary integer valuebyte
character valuecomment valueint
error valuedouble
floating point valuelong
hex integer valuetoken identifier valuelong
integer valuelong
64-bit integer valuelong
octal integer valuestring valuetoken symbol valuevoid
setFieldVBinary
(long v_binary) token binary integer valuevoid
setFieldVChar
(byte v_char) character valuevoid
setFieldVComment
(Str v_comment) comment valuevoid
setFieldVError
(int v_error) error valuevoid
setFieldVFloat
(double v_float) floating point valuevoid
setFieldVHex
(long v_hex) hex integer valuevoid
setFieldVIdentifier
(Str v_identifier) token identifier valuevoid
setFieldVInt
(long v_int) integer valuevoid
setFieldVInt64
(long v_int64) 64-bit integer valuevoid
setFieldVOctal
(long v_octal) octal integer valuevoid
setFieldVString
(Str v_string) string valuevoid
setFieldVSymbol
(Pointer v_symbol) token symbol valueVon Klasse geerbte Methoden ch.bailu.gtk.type.Pointer
asCPointer, cast, connectSignal, disconnectSignals, disconnectSignals, equals, hashCode, throwIfNull, throwNullPointerException, toString, unregisterCallbacks, unregisterCallbacks
Von Klasse geerbte Methoden ch.bailu.gtk.type.Type
asCPointer, asCPointer, asCPointerNotNull, asJnaPointer, asJnaPointer, asPointer, asPointer, cast, cast, throwIfNull
Von Klasse geerbte Methoden java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
Von Schnittstelle geerbte Methoden ch.bailu.gtk.type.PointerInterface
asCPointerNotNull, asJnaPointer, asPointer, isNotNull, isNull
-
Felddetails
-
V_SYMBOL
token symbol value- Siehe auch:
-
V_IDENTIFIER
token identifier value- Siehe auch:
-
V_BINARY
token binary integer value- Siehe auch:
-
V_OCTAL
octal integer value- Siehe auch:
-
V_INT
integer value- Siehe auch:
-
V_INT64
64-bit integer value- Siehe auch:
-
V_FLOAT
floating point value- Siehe auch:
-
V_HEX
hex integer value- Siehe auch:
-
V_STRING
string value- Siehe auch:
-
V_COMMENT
comment value- Siehe auch:
-
V_CHAR
character value- Siehe auch:
-
V_ERROR
error value- Siehe auch:
-
-
Konstruktordetails
-
TokenValue
-
TokenValue
public TokenValue()
-
-
Methodendetails
-
getClassHandler
-
setFieldVSymbol
token symbol value -
getFieldVSymbol
token symbol value -
setFieldVIdentifier
token identifier value -
getFieldVIdentifier
token identifier value -
setFieldVBinary
public void setFieldVBinary(long v_binary) token binary integer value -
getFieldVBinary
public long getFieldVBinary()token binary integer value -
setFieldVOctal
public void setFieldVOctal(long v_octal) octal integer value -
getFieldVOctal
public long getFieldVOctal()octal integer value -
setFieldVInt
public void setFieldVInt(long v_int) integer value -
getFieldVInt
public long getFieldVInt()integer value -
setFieldVInt64
public void setFieldVInt64(long v_int64) 64-bit integer value -
getFieldVInt64
public long getFieldVInt64()64-bit integer value -
setFieldVFloat
public void setFieldVFloat(double v_float) floating point value -
getFieldVFloat
public double getFieldVFloat()floating point value -
setFieldVHex
public void setFieldVHex(long v_hex) hex integer value -
getFieldVHex
public long getFieldVHex()hex integer value -
setFieldVString
string value -
getFieldVString
string value -
setFieldVComment
comment value -
getFieldVComment
comment value -
setFieldVChar
public void setFieldVChar(byte v_char) character value -
getFieldVChar
public byte getFieldVChar()character value -
setFieldVError
public void setFieldVError(int v_error) error value -
getFieldVError
public int getFieldVError()error value
-